Output 25e43e10524fa3a4583966b8a3a1b4642239926e00ed0ecf61808da5f8a84dd7:0

value
59589464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ec9fb9b53db10bd9ddefacf8d0a797daea2f65b OP_EQUAL
address
MCAZHGW2BkRnVAr6ptmTccsWr6YkELuqGh
transaction
25e43e10524fa3a4583966b8a3a1b4642239926e00ed0ecf61808da5f8a84dd7
spent
true